School Description

Birley Community College is a larger than average-sized secondary school. The vast majority of students are from White British backgrounds. The proportion of disadvantaged students supported by pupil premium funding is slightly below average. The pupil premium is additional funding provided for students who are known to be eligible for free school meals and those who are looked after by the local authority. The proportion of students who are disabled or who have special educational needs is above average. The school has specialist resourced provision for students with autism. Twenty-four students are on roll with bespoke support which enables them to access approximately 80% of their timetable in mainstream lessons. A very small number of students make use of alternative provision. The main providers include Education in Angling, Recycle, Heeley City Farm and Whirlow farm. Birley Community College is part of a federation with Birley Community Primary School. The two schools share the same leadership, governance and campus. The school does not enter students early for GCSE examinations The school meets the government’s current floor standards, which are the minimum expectations for students’ attainment and progress in English and mathematics by the end of Year 11.
